Electrical resistivity, magnetoresistance and magnetic susceptibility were measured for ceramic (La<sub>1−y</sub> Pr<sub>y</sub>)<sub>0.7</sub>Ca<sub>0.3</sub>MnO<sub>3</sub> samples (y 0.75 and 1) with different content of <sup>18</sup>O isotope. All samples were paramagnetic insulators in the high-temperature range. Some of them became ferromagnetic (FM) metals at temperatures below 60–80 K. The high-temperature behaviour of the resistivity, magnetoresistance and magnetic susceptibility was practically identical for all samples in spite of the significant difference in their low-temperature properties. In particular, the magnetoresistance was proportional to the magnetic field squared and decreased approximately as 1/T<sup>5</sup> in a wide magnetic field and temperature range. The results were interpreted based on the concept of an inhomogeneous state with pronounced FM correlations in the paramagnetic phase. |
